Korean BBQ Beef Short Ribs

Experience the bold and savory flavors of Korean BBQ with these succulent beef short ribs. The marinade combines soy sauce, brown sugar, and aromatic spices, creating a perfect balance of sweetness and umami. Grilled to perfection, these ribs are a delightful and satisfying meal for any barbecue enthusiast.

Ingredients:

  • 3 lbs beef short ribs
  • 1 cup soy sauce
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up rice vinegar
  • 1/4 cup sesame o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on ginger, grated
  • 2 tablespoons mirin
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 green onions,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on toasted sesame seeds

Instructions:

In a bowl, mix soy sauce, brown sugar, rice vinegar, sesame oil, garlic, ginger, mirin, honey, and black pepper to create the marinade

Place beef short ribs in a large resealable plastic bag and pour the marinade over them

Seal the bag and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ight

Preheat the grill to medium-high heat

Remove ribs from the marinade, allowing excess to drip off, and grill for 5-7 minutes per side or until desired doneness is reached

While grilling, baste the ribs with the remaining marinade for added flavor

Once cooked, sprinkle with green onions and toasted sesame seeds

Serve hot and enjoy

Spinach Artichoke Dip

This Spinach Artichoke Dip is a traditional party food that is rich, creamy, and full of flavor. Its great for gatherings, parties, or a cozy night in. Ingredients: 1 10 ounce package frozen chopped spinach, thawed and drained 1 14 ounce can artichoke hearts, drained and chopped 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ese 1/2 cup mayonnaise 1/2 cup sour cream 1 teaspoon minced garlic 1/2 teaspoon salt 1/4 teaspoon black pepper Instructions: Preheat oven to 375F 190C In a medium mixing bowl, combine all ingredients until well mixed Transfer the mixture into a baking dish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and the dip is bubbly Serve hot with tortilla chips, crackers, or sliced baguette
